Understanding the Benefits of Tub to Shower Conversion

Converting a tub to a shower can create more open space and improve bathroom accessibility, especially for households with older adults or children. It's an opportunity to customize your bathing area to fit your everyday needs and lifestyle. Here are some notable benefits:

  • Improved Safety: Showers typically offer less risk of slips and falls compared to bathtubs.
  • Space Efficiency: Showers take up less room, making your bathroom feel larger.
  • Stylish Design: Modern shower fixtures and designs can elevate the look of your bathroom.

Key Steps in the Conversion Process

Converting your tub to a shower is feasible as a DIY project or can be handed over to professionals. Here are the essential steps I took during my conversion:

Step Description
Planning Determine the layout and design you want for your new shower.
Demolition Remove the existing tub and prepare the area for construction.
Installation Set up shower plumbing, fixtures, and tiles as per your design.
Finishing Touches Seal everything and add accessories like shower curtains or doors.

Cost Considerations and Budgeting

Before starting your conversion, it’s vital to understand the potential costs involved. Typically, the price can vary based on materials, labor, and design complexity. For more specific price estimates, it's useful to refer to local contractors or online resources. Factors affecting the conversion cost include:

  • Type of materials used (tiles, fixtures, etc.)
  • Labor conditions (DIY vs. hiring a contractor)
  • Additional features (e.g., shelving, lighting)
